patch 9.1.0200: `gj`/`gk` not skipping over outer virtual text lines Commit: https://github.com/vim/vim/commit/b2d124c6258ff41e1f951bf39a4afc386d79ddc4 Author: Dylan Thacker-Smith <dylan.ah.smith@gmail.com> Date: Sun Mar 24 09:43:25 2024 +0100 patch 9.1.0200: `gj`/`gk` not skipping over outer virtual text lines Problem: `gj`/`gk` was updating the desired cursor virtual column to the outer virtual text, even though the actual cursor position was moved to not be on the virtual text, leading the need to do an extra `gj`/`gk` to move past each virtual text line. (rickhowe) Solution: Exclude the outer virtual text when getting the line length for moving the cursor with `gj`/`gk`, so that no extra movement is needed to skip over virtual text lines. @echo off
rem To be used on MS-Windows for Visual C++ 2017 or later.
rem See INSTALLpc.txt for information.
rem
rem Usage:
rem   For x86 builds run this with "x86" option:
rem     msvc-latest x86
rem   For x64 builds run this with "x86_amd64" option or "x64" option:
rem     msvc-latest x86_amd64
rem     msvc-latest x64
rem
rem Optional environment variables:
rem   VSWHERE:
rem     Full path to vswhere.exe.
rem   VSVEROPT:
rem     Option to search specific version of Visual Studio.
rem     Default: -latest
rem     To search VS2017:
rem       set "VSVEROPT=-version [15.0^,16.0^)"
rem     To search VS2019:
rem       set "VSVEROPT=-version [16.0^,17.0^)"
rem     To search VS2022:
rem       set "VSVEROPT=-version [17.0^,18.0^)"

if "%VSWHERE%"=="" (
	set "VSWHERE=%ProgramFiles(x86)%\Microsoft Visual Studio\Installer\vswhere.exe"
	set VSWHERE_SET=yes
)
if not exist "%VSWHERE%" (
	echo Error: vswhere not found.
	set VSWHERE=
	set VSWHERE_SET=
	exit /b 1
)

if "%VSVEROPT%"=="" (
	set VSVEROPT=-latest
	set VSVEROPT_SET=yes
)

rem Search Visual Studio Community, Professional or above.
for /f "usebackq tokens=*" %%i in (`"%VSWHERE%" %VSVEROPT% -products * -requires Microsoft.VisualStudio.Component.VC.Tools.x86.x64 -property installationPath`) do (
	set InstallDir=%%i
)
if exist "%InstallDir%\VC\Auxiliary\Build\vcvarsall.bat" (
	call "%InstallDir%\VC\Auxiliary\Build\vcvarsall.bat" %*
	goto done
)

rem Search Visual Studio 2017 Express.
rem (Visual Studio 2017 Express uses different component IDs.)
for /f "usebackq tokens=*" %%i in (`"%VSWHERE%" %VSVEROPT% -products Microsoft.VisualStudio.Product.WDExpress -property installationPath`) do (
	set InstallDir=%%i
)
if exist "%InstallDir%\VC\Auxiliary\Build\vcvarsall.bat" (
	call "%InstallDir%\VC\Auxiliary\Build\vcvarsall.bat" %*
) else (
	echo Error: vcvarsall.bat not found.
	rem Set ERRORLEVEL to 1.
	call
)

:done
if "%VSWHERE_SET%"=="yes" (
	set VSWHERE=
	set VSWHERE_SET=
)
if "%VSVEROPT_SET%"=="yes" (
	set VSVEROPT=
	set VSVEROPT_SET=
)
set InstallDir=
